Anger Motivational Quotes



Best Quotes about Anger

1.
The discretion of a man deferreth his anger; and it is his glory to pass over a transgression. [Proverbs 19:11]
Bible

2.
If you do not wish to be prone to anger, do not feed the habit; give it nothing which may tend to its increase.
Epictetus

3.
The worst tempered people I have ever met were those who knew that they were wrong.
Mizner, Wilson

4.
The secret of reaping the greatest fruitfulness and the greatest enjoyment from life is to live dangerously.
Nietzsche, Friedrich

5.
If a man meets with injustice, it is not required that he shall not be roused to meet it; but if he is angry after he has had time to think upon it, that is sinful. The flame is not wring, but the coals are.
Beecher, Henry Ward

6.
Never forget what a person says to you when they are angry.
Beecher, Henry Ward

7.
Holding on to anger, resentment and hurt only gives you tense muscles, a headache and a sore jaw from clenching your teeth. Forgiveness gives you back the laughter and the lightness in your life.
Joan Lunden

8.
To rule one's anger is well; to prevent it is better.
Edwards, Tryon

9.
I may be compelled to face danger, but never fear it, and while our soldiers can stand and fight, I can stand and feed and nurse them.
Barton, Clara

10.
My dear brothers, take note of this: Everyone should be quick to listen, slow to speak and slow to become angry, for man's anger does not bring about the righteous life that God desires. [James 1:19-20]
Bible

11.
An angry man opens his mouth and shuts his eyes.
Cato The Elder

12.
Speak when you are angry--and you will make the best speech you'll ever regret.
Laurence J. Peter

13.
Usually when people are sad, they don't do anything. They just cry over their condition. But when they get angry, they bring about a change.
Malcolm X

14.
Holding on to anger is like grasping a hot coal with the intent of throwing it at someone else; you are the one getting burned.
Buddha

15.
I destroy my enemy when I make him my friend.
Lincoln, Abraham

16.
There's nothing wrong with anger provided you use it constructively.
Dyer, Wayne

17.
He who is slow to anger has great understanding, but he who has a hasty temper exalts folly.
Proverb

18.
The continuance and frequent fits of anger produce in the soul a propensity to be angry; which oftentimes ends in choler, bitterness, and moronity, when the mid becomes ulcerated, peevish, and querulous, and is wounded by the least occurrence.
Beecher, Henry Ward

19.
Great perils have this beauty, that they bring to light the fraternity of strangers.
Hugo, Victor

20.
Send danger from the east unto the west, so honor cross it from the north to south.
Shakespeare, William

21.
The most dangerous thing is illusion.
Emerson, Ralph Waldo

22.
The person who runs away exposes himself to that very danger more than a person who sits quietly.
Nehru, Jawaharlal

23.
If a small thing has the power to make you angry, does that not indicate something about your size?
Harris, Sidney J.

24.
Doomed are the hotheads! Unhappy are they who lose their cool and are too proud to say, I'm sorry.
Schuller, Robert H.

25.
He best keeps from anger who remembers that God is always looking upon him.
Plato

26.
He took over anger to intimidate subordinates, and in time anger took over him.
Magnus, Saint Albertus

27.
Let not the sun go down upon your wrath. [Ephesians 4:26]
Bible

28.
Anger is a great force. If you control it, it can be transmuted into a power which can move the whole world.
Sivananda, Sri Swami

29.
Anger: an acid that can do more harm to the vessel in which it is stored than to anything on which it is poured.
Seneca

30.
There is nobody who is not dangerous for someone.
SeVigne, Marquise De

31.
Whenever you get red in the face, whenever you raise your voice, whenever you get hot under the collar or angry, rebellious or negative in spirit, then know that the spirit of God is leaving you and the spirit of Satan is beginning to take over.

32.
Man should forget his anger before he lies down to sleep.
Quincey, Thomas De

33.
As the whirlwind in its fury teareth up trees, and deformeth the face of nature, or as an earthquake in its convulsions overturneth whole cities; so the rage of an angry man throweth mischief around him.
Akhenaton

34.
Anyone can become angry -- that is easy. But to be angry with the right person, to the right degree, at the right time, for the right purpose, and in the right way -- this is not easy.
Aristotle

35.
There are good and bad times, but our mood changes more often than our fortune.
Renard, Jules

36.
When anger rises, think of the consequences.
Confucius

37.
The moment one accosts a stranger or is accosted by him is above all in this life the moment of drama... Whoever we meet watches us intently at the quick, strange moment of meeting, to see whether we are disposed to be friendly.
Long, Haniel

38.
When the danger is past God is cheated.
Proverb, Italian

39.
The one who cannot restrain their anger will wish undone, what their temper and irritation prompted them to do.
Horace

40.
Actually, the streets are quite safe today, it's the people on them who aren't.

41.
In a controversy the instant we feel anger we have already ceased striving for the truth, and have begun striving for ourselves.
Carlyle, Thomas

42.
One ought never to turn one's back on a threatened danger and try to run away from it. If you do that, you will double the danger. But if you meet it promptly and without flinching, you will reduce the danger by half. Never run away from anything. Never!
Emerson, Ralph Waldo

43.
A soft answer truth away wrath, but grievous words stir up anger. [Proverbs 15:1]
Bible

44.
Constant exposure to dangers will breed contempt for them.
Seneca

45.
When angry, count to ten before you speak. If very angry, count to one hundred.
Jefferson, Thomas

46.
When danger approaches, sing to it.
Proverb, Arabian

47.
A vigorous temper is not altogether an evil. Men who are easy as an old shoe are generally of little worth.
Spurgeon, Charles Haddon

48.
Eat a third and drink a third and leave the remaining third of your stomach empty. Then, when you get angry, there will be sufficient room for your rage.
Babylonian Talmud

49.
When thou art above measure angry, bethink thee how momentary is man's life.
Aurelius, Marcus

50.
Many have had their greatness made for them by their enemies.
Gracian, Baltasar
